What does a “New Life” look like?

2 Corinthians 5: 17Therefore, if anyone is in Christ, he is a new creation; the old has gone, the new has come! 18All this is from God, who reconciled us to himself through Christ and gave us the ministry of reconciliation: 19that God was reconciling the world to himself in Christ, not counting men's sins against them. And he has committed to us the message of reconciliation.

 
================

We could always tell when it was the weekend not because of the obvious glance at the calendar. Our phone would start to ring and the main question was “is there going to be a party in your room?” In fact when we got an apartment we expanded party central to new heights. We received twenty one phone calls in ten minutes!
  • My life is GOD’s and HE wants me to proclaim the message about HIS SON.
  • My example “is” important and determines whether I will be heard or not.
  • My actions do speak louder than words so my actions need to be in line with GOD.

After college I tried to take my partying ways into the church and for some reason it didn’t quite feel the same. My message of forgiveness while being dedicated to GOD who saved me just didn’t mix well with cursing at someone at a grocery store or being tipsy and flirtatious in bars. I had to find a “new life.”

 
My confusion of what a “new life” looked like came from my lack of understanding GOD and HIS purpose for my life.
  • GOD made me for HIS purpose not mine.
  • HE desires that I spend some of my time on earth proclaiming the Great News about HIS SON.
  • GOD blesses me when I give up my selfishness and I attempt to live for HIM.

There were many who questioned the validity of my “new life.” “Will he stick to it” probably ran through their minds. “Why are you trying to act goody, goody” is another. Or better yet "Look at him going through his problems, I wonder will he crumble?" BUT GOD wants me to review all areas of my life and be an open book to my sin so that people may believe in HIS SON and that’s all that matters.

 
I still look at my life and try to remove barriers to someone believing in GOD’s SON. I am not trying to “work” my way into Heaven; rather I have realized that my walk is just as important as my “talk.”
  • GOD doesn’t expect me to be sinless; HE did that HIMSELF.
  • GOD wants me to show love to people who don’t deserve it like HE did for me.
  • GOD desires that I acquire faith instead of fear so that people will be drawn to HIM by my example.
  • GOD wants me to willingly give up worldly pleasure for a moment only to get eternal pleasure.

A “New Life” is not a sinless life rather it is one dedicated to proclaiming a message of grace not judgment. I’m glad HE gave me a new life!
